In an advanced heat engine course, we propose using a spreadsheet application to assist in the study of a reciprocating engine model, where the fluid composition changes and the parameters depend on the temperature. This application performs the fluid cycle analysis of different engines and also provides experience to students about computational procedures in heat engines. © 2010 Wiley Periodicals, Inc.
